2. Analyse Digital
Analyse Digital is a digital marketing and analytics-focused company based in India, working with businesses that want to outsource parts of their marketing operations. Their work often sits at the intersection of campaign execution and data analysis, where performance tracking and customer insights are part of everyday marketing activity rather than a separate function.
They approach analytics as something that runs alongside digital campaigns. This includes understanding customer behavior, tracking performance across channels, and using that data to adjust ongoing marketing efforts. Their structure suggests they work with a mix of companies - from early-stage businesses to more established teams that need external execution support.

3. Swajyot Technologies
Swajyot Technologies focuses more directly on analytics outsourcing, with services built around the full data lifecycle rather than just marketing execution. Their approach leans into building structured analytics processes for companies that either don’t have in-house capabilities or need additional support to scale existing setups.
Their work covers areas like data integration, reporting, and predictive analytics, which can feed into marketing analytics when connected to campaign data and customer behavior tracking. They also highlight automation and infrastructure, suggesting their role often goes beyond reporting into setting up systems that support ongoing analysis.

4. Outsourced
Outsourced works as a staffing and operations provider that helps companies build offshore marketing teams in India. Their model is centered around providing dedicated roles rather than packaged services, which means marketing analytics often sits alongside other functions like content, advertising, or CRM. Companies typically use them when they need ongoing analytical support but prefer to keep strategy and direction internally.
Their involvement in marketing analytics comes through roles such as data analysts, marketing analytics specialists, and business intelligence support. These roles are integrated into the client’s existing workflows, handling tasks like data tracking, reporting, and research. Instead of running campaigns themselves, they focus on supplying people who can support analytics processes as part of a broader marketing setup.

14. LatentView Analytics
LatentView Analytics works specifically with marketing analytics and consulting, where the focus is on understanding how marketing activities perform and how they can be improved. Their work usually involves analyzing customer journeys, campaign performance, and channel effectiveness.
They approach marketing analytics as a continuous process that connects data from different touchpoints. This includes identifying where conversions drop, understanding how different channels contribute to results, and using that information to guide decisions. Their services also include building systems that support ongoing analysis rather than one-time reporting.

Conclusion
If there’s one thing that stands out after going through these companies, it’s how differently marketing analytics outsourcing is handled in practice. Some teams focus on raw data and infrastructure, others sit closer to campaigns and reporting, and a few blend analytics with research or broader marketing work. There isn’t a single model that fits everyone, and that’s probably the point.
For companies considering outsourcing to India, the real decision usually comes down to how much of the analytics function they want to hand over. Sometimes it’s just extra hands for reporting and dashboards. In other cases, it turns into a more embedded setup where the external team becomes part of the day-to-day marketing workflow. Both approaches show up here, just in different forms.
It’s also worth noticing that analytics doesn’t really live on its own anymore. In most cases, it’s tied to content, campaigns, customer data, or even product decisions. So choosing a partner is less about finding “analytics” in isolation and more about finding a setup that fits how your marketing actually runs.
At the end of the day, outsourcing works best when it removes friction - fewer delays in reporting, clearer insights, less guesswork. The companies in this list approach that goal from different angles, but they’re all trying to solve the same underlying problem: making data easier to work with, and a bit more useful when decisions need to be made.
